    right now I’m mostly production QA focusing on keeping work instructions and control plans updated. I’m slated early next year to stay in QA but focus more strategically to conduct audits, maintain our plant level approval processes, our non conformances and non conforming material controls. A lot of it is driving investigations either in failure analysis or root cause analysis, and putting in a permanent corrective action so that the same things can’t happen again. I’m also our repair station QA systems manager (nobody reports to me) so I manage 2 quality manuals and our EASA supplement to the FAA manual (the CAAC being the other qa manual) as well as doing final inspection and approvals to ship for the FAA repair station. I’m also working on several new product development roll outs where we work directly with suppliers and customers and ensure supplier abilities and customer conformances.
